Potato as a mass noun is quite uncommon unless you’re referring to the entire crop, as in “I plant ten acres of potato every year.”

When do you use potato as a mass noun?

Potato as a mass noun is uncommon in every usage, but less uncommon than usual in agriculture. If the recipe referred to a potato mash or grated potato, even for mise en place, you’d still specify it as “350g of potatoes, mashed/grated.” – Backgammon Aug 16 ’13 at 13:56.

Is there a misspelling of the word potato?

The word potatos is a common misspelling of potatoes —although, as you can see below, it really isn’t that common. Since the singular noun potato ends in the letter O, it is easy to see why many writers are tempted to pluralize it to potatos. After all, burrito becomes burritos, semipro becomes semipros, and banjo becomes banjos.
